"Human desire is a path to spiritual wholeness, says author Donald Boisvert, in this evocative look at how saints - and one's devotion to them - can be sites for the confirmation and celebration of homoerotic desire. The author comes to the topic as a gay scholar of religion and draws upon his own experience of saints including his years in seminary beginning at age thirteen. Saints can inspire desire and, through eclectic readings of their lives and imagery, the author suggests meanings and strategies attached to the emergence of same-sex attraction."--BOOK JACKET.
